James Johnson raises to 10,000 at 2-4,000

Aaron Brunskill 3 bets to 25,000

James calls

8-6-3 flop all diamonds

James checks

Aaron 25,000

James shove 110,000

call

Aaron A-A with the Ace of diamonds

James Q-Q with the Queen of diamonds

Brick, Brick

Johnson out 30th

Aaron up over 300,000 about 1.5x average


29 left, 27 paid

The remaining 27 receive the following

1    -    £26,299
2    -    £15,197
3    -    £9,100
4    -    £6,370
5    -    £5,005
6    -    £4,095
7    -    £3,640
8    -    £2,912
9    -    £2,457
10    -    £1,911
11    -    £1,820
12    -    £1,820
13    -    £1,820
14    -    £1,729
15    -    £1,729
16    -    £1,729
17    -    £1,729
18    -    £1,638
19    -    £1,000
20    -    £1,000
21    -    £1,000
22    -    £1,000
23    -    £1,000
24    -    £1,000
25    -    £1,000
26    -    £1,000
27    -    £1,000

Break after 15 levels

27 left

blinds go 2500-5000

Average 200,000

Top 5


Mad Turk 650,000

Garry Robertson 450,000

Kurt Goodwin 450,000

Anonymous 400,000

Aaron Brunskill 350,000


Three more levels to play. Doubt we'll make a final tonight with this excellent structure, but we might be down to two tables come 12am tonight....
